HIP 75533
HIP 75533 is a K-type (Orange) star.
Located approximately 360.8 light-years from Earth, HIP 75533 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.
HIP 75533 is classified as a spectral class K star (K-type (Orange)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.
HIP 75533 has an apparent magnitude of +9.13,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.523.
